  2. Freeze warning -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Freeze_Warning

    A freeze warning is a warning issued by the National Weather Service when sub-freezing temperatures are expected in the next 36 hours. This can occur with or without frost . [ 1 ] When a freeze warning is issued in the fall , that will usually signify the end of the growing season , as sub-freezing temperatures will usually kill all remaining ...

  8. Freeze watch -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Freeze_watch

    A freeze watch is a notice issued by the National Weather Service that announces that temperatures of 32 °F (0 °C) and below is possible in the next 48 hours. This watch is only issued during the growing season when the freezing temperature may damage or kill unharvested crops, which would end the growing season.
